The psychosocial burden is particularly impactful in children, adolescents, and young adults who would otherwise be healthy and experiencing a normal” life, yet are struggling with a very visible disease (Remröd, Sjoström, & Svensson, 2013 ). Psoriasis is independently associated with major depression; this increased risk is the same between individuals with limited or extensive psoriasis (Cohen, Martires, & Ho, 2016 ). In addition, patients with psoriasis use more antidepressants than matched controls (Dowlatshahi, Wakkee, Arends, & Nijsten, 2014 ). Further, patients with psoriasis have been shown to be at increased risk of myocardial infarction, stroke, and cardiac death, especially when experiencing acute depression (Egeberg et al., 2016 ; Gelfand et al., 2006 , 2009 ; Mehta et al., 2010 ).

Evidence synthesis (i.e. a literature review) involves the integrating of available evidence to reach a justified conclusion. The most rigorous review methodology is called a systematic review, in which the aim is to synthesise all, or nearly all, available evidence relating to a particular question. Other review methodologies also exist , and we would position the 2014 review as a ‘systematized review’, i.e. one which includes elements of a systematic review process while stopping short of being a full systematic review.
